Description
Composition
Telvis Plus Tablet 80 Mg/12.5Mg is a combination of two active ingredients: Telmisartan and Hydrochlorothiazide. Telmisartan is an angiotensin receptor blocker (ARB) that works by blocking the hormone angiotensin, which relaxes the blood vessels. Hydrochlorothiazide is a diuretic that helps to reduce the amount of water in the body, which in turn lowers blood pressure.
How it Works
As mentioned, Telmisartan in Telvis Plus Tablet 80 Mg/12.5Mg works by blocking the hormone angiotensin. By doing so, it helps to relax the blood vessels and improve blood flow, which lowers blood pressure. Hydrochlorothiazide, on the other hand, helps to reduce the amount of water in the body, which also helps to lower blood pressure.
Dosage and Administration
The dosage of Telvis Plus Tablet 80 Mg/12.5Mg will vary depending on the patient’s condition and response to the medication. It’s important to follow the instructions of a healthcare professional when taking this medication. Typically, the recommended dosage is one tablet taken once a day, with or without food.
Side Effects
Like all medications, Telvis Plus Tablet 80 Mg/12.5Mg can cause side effects. Some of the common side effects may include dizziness, back pain, muscle spasms, myalgia, chest pain, and erectile dysfunction. If you experience any side effects while taking this medication, it’s important to speak with your healthcare provider immediately.
